If you have ever used Kilz, chances are you know that it is a very difficult paint to remove from skin. Kilz is a brand of paint that is designed to be highly adhesive and stain-resistant, making it difficult to get off skin. However, there are a few methods that you can use to get Kilz off of your skin.

The first thing you should do is to try and remove the Kilz from your skin as soon as possible. The longer it stays on, the harder it will be to remove. The best way to do this is to use a pair of latex gloves when handling Kilz. This will help to prevent it from getting on your skin in the first place.

If you do get Kilz on your skin, the first thing you should do is to try using soap and water. Soap and water can often be enough to remove the paint, but you may need to scrub it off with a soft brush. Make sure to use a mild soap and lukewarm water.
